This book is a very personal account of a woman's journey through depression. In The Eye of the Storm, Sandra Parker writes about her struggle with depression and how she fought her way back. While the book tells about this one woman's struggles, it will promote thought for many women who have fought hard to keep going even though the down times can be exhausting. The Eye of the Storm gives an account on how to go about empowering oneself and finding the happiness we all deserve. Facing the loss of a loved one along with financial difficulties, this single Mom who struggled so hard through life to keep her head above the water, succumbs to the apathy she feels. Ignoring all that is good around her, she does not want to leave her room. By the Grace of God, one day she wakes up from this dilemma and decides that she will survive. She begins by accepting responsibility fo her part in the mess she is in and then she proceeds to make peace with the pains that have haunted her all along. The subject of the book is not a happy one, but the book itself is inspiring and its words will reach many.
